Crypto Market Rebounds as Bitcoin, XRP, and BNB Regain Momentum
The broader crypto market is staging a sharp rebound, with total capitalization climbing back above $3.2 trillion and adding a little over 4% in the past 24 hours as risk appetite tentatively returns. Bitcoin is leading the move, trading back over $90,000 after jumping 4.9% on the day, helped by cooling volatility and signs that forced liquidations have finally eased.
XRP is participating in the bounce but with a slightly different driver set. The token is consolidating around the $2.20 level after a series of strong sessions tied to the debut of spot XRP ETFs in the U.S., which have already attracted tens of millions of dollars in inflows and sparked renewed whale accumulation. That institutional bid has improved XRP’s medium-term outlook, even if today’s percentage move fails behind Bitcoin’s.
BNB, meanwhile, is trading just under $900, up around 3.7% over the last 24 hours but still 21% negative on the month, underperforming both BTC and the wider large-cap basket.
